NHR Computational Life Science-Support
Six NHR centers cooperate in the NHR Computational Life Science-support, which is coordinated by NHR@TUD and NHR@ZIB.
Life Science support covers a wide range of research areas, including basic research, medicinal analysis using secure computing and AI, and simulation approaches. Support for Life Sciences focuses on two main areas: simulation and data-intensive research.
Through collaboration among the centers within the NHR alliance, users benefit from a broad pool of expertise, more than any single center can provide.
The participating centers are: NHR@TUD, NHR@ZIB, NHR@Göttingen, NHR@SW, NHR@FAU and NHR4CES@RWTH.
Simulation-based applications
Coordinated by NHR@ZIB
This subgroup provides support for scientific simulation problems that are solved in areas such as biophysics, biochemistry, molecular dynamics, and structural biology, which require high computational performance. The limitations of hardware and software with respect to speed, capacity, and availability necessitate efficient resource usage.
The aim of the support is to enable HPC workloads and AI applications on NHR systems. The support team members have a strong life science research background as well as HPC experience.
Offers:
- Regular contact with users and research groups to identify needs
- Technical and scientific consulting for user projects, including software selection, workflow optimization, and efficient usage of NHR systems
- Direct user engagement to increase visibility and accessibility of NHR support

Data-intensive research
Coordinated by NHR@TUD
Support for data-intensive Life Science research includes expertise in managing processing and analyzing large-scale biological and medical datasets on HPC systems. Service includes guidance and training on specific software, optimized workflows, secure computing environments and AI-based analysis methods.
The support team members have a strong Life Science research background as well as HPC experience.
